John Deere 8245R vs John Deere 9120
Verdict: John Deere 8245R vs John Deere 9120
The John Deere 8245R and the John Deere 9120 are both tractors — here is how they stack up on the figures that matter. Both are rated at the same 245 hp. John Deere 8245R is the lighter machine (25,868 kg vs 30,970 kg), which helps on soft ground and transport, while the heavier model carries more ballast for traction-limited draft work. John Deere 8245R is the newer design (2009 vs 2002). Use the full side-by-side spec tables below to weigh the details against your own operation, and confirm with a dealer demo.
